Default A4 700r4(4l60) questions

Just bought a motor and tranny

93 Fbody is what is came out of and it is for my 93Z28 (eventually)

Quick questions:

1) I know my tranny in my car and the one I just bought (non electronic) has the TV cable to the throttle body, the 4l60E (electronic) does not right?
2) The speed sensor/and plug on the non electronic is different than the 4l60E right?
3) The plug for the hook up is a five pin round plug on the transmission that I bought this is different than the 4l60e as in what does that plug look like for the 4l60E (electronic)?

Thanks for any help.

Yes the 4l60e has no TV cable, its plugged. The 5 pin connector is another way of knowing its a 700r4.

The '93 4l60 has a 5 pin connector, the prior 700r4 has a 4 pin connector.
